Summary

DANA CONTAINER, INC. has accumulated 14 OSHA violations across 2 inspections over 22 years of recorded history, with $33,436 in total assessed penalties.

The establishment sits in the 95th percentile for violations within its industry-state peer group of 22 employers. Inspection frequency runs at the 67th percentile. The most recent enforcement activity was recorded 1 year ago.
